Output 0c3f70130cd25863597c3e6dccf82bcd31a7e6d94dfac2de7f1975f8d4453ad2:61

value
1415635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646329cbdb30c6274464b0c33b07e8a7aad4a3e7 OP_EQUAL
address
3AqpHiDHhNxzJi53UUteNyxiy57aXpq72i
transaction
0c3f70130cd25863597c3e6dccf82bcd31a7e6d94dfac2de7f1975f8d4453ad2
spent
true